A leading global technology company in Northern Ireland is seeking an experienced Senior Commercial & Privacy Counsel to join its in-house legal team. This pivotal role involves advising on complex commercial agreements and global data protection matters while engaging with senior stakeholders.
The ideal candidate is a qualified lawyer with over 6 years of experience, strong commercial contracts expertise, and a proactive approach. This position offers flexible working arrangements and opportunities for career progression.

How to prepare for a job interview at Conekt Legal
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of commercial agreements and data protection laws. Familiarise yourself with the latest trends in privacy regulations, especially those relevant to global tech. This will show that you're not just qualified but also genuinely interested in the field.
✨Engage with Stakeholders
Since this role involves working with senior stakeholders, practice how you'll communicate complex legal concepts in a straightforward manner. Think about examples from your past experience where you've successfully navigated stakeholder relationships and be ready to share those stories.
✨Show Your Proactive Side
Prepare to discuss instances where you've taken initiative in your previous roles. Whether it was identifying potential legal risks or streamlining contract processes, showcasing your proactive approach will resonate well with the interviewers.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t shy away from asking questions that demonstrate your interest in the company’s future and its legal challenges. Inquire about their current projects or how they handle evolving data protection issues. This shows that you’re thinking ahead and are keen to contribute.
